## In short

Cafe Dongi Daemyeong Station Branch is a Korean set-meal restaurant that opened in September 2026 in an alley behind the Anjirang post office in Daemyeong-dong, Nam-gu, Daegu, with set meals in the ₩10,000 range. The writer ordered the grandma-style stir-fried jjukkumi (webfoot octopus) set meal, the flame-grilled pork set meal and a tasting-size sweet and sour pork, and fried egg, five-grain rice, seaweed, hovenia tea and barley gangjeong (puffed barley snack) were all free to refill. The wide single-floor dining room has everything from solo seats to group tables and baby chairs, so Cafe Dongi works for both solo meals and family dinners.

## Cafe Dongi's signature nuruk-aged sweet and sour pork

The crispy fried nuruk (fermented grain) tangsuyuk is Cafe Dongi's signature dish, so it's definitely worth trying at least once.

![Crispy fried nuruk-aged tangsuyuk](https://img.superchart.com/images/cafe-dongi-daemyeong-station-new-branch/cafe-dongi-daemyeong-station-new-branch-22-xf548-966.webp)

It uses no flour at all — instead it's aged for 72 hours with traditional rice nuruk and freshly fried, so it didn't sit heavy after eating, which I liked.
